Announcing the Ontario Art Book Fair, Saturday, March 29
The Department of Museum, Arts & Culture announces the Ontario Art Book Fair on Saturday, March 29, 2025, from 11 AM – 5 PM. This free one-day event showcases regional artists' books, catalogues, monographs, periodicals, and zines. The Museum will open its art galleries to fifty exhibitors including publishing houses, independent press collectives, artists, zine-makers, printmakers, and individuals practicing in experimental paper formats.

Ontario Announces Trap-Neuter-Release (TNR) Program
Ontario is pleased to announce the development of a new Trap-Neuter-Release (TNR) Program for community cats. Feral and stray cats in Ontario can be humanely trapped by City residents and brought to a partnering veterinary hospital for spay or neutering at no cost to the resident.

Rise Up and Read This Winter
Rise up and read this winter! Beginning in January, Ontario City Library will launch Rise – a new service that offers free reading assistance and instruction to children in kindergarten through second grade.
